Alexander Foreman, Photographer, Glass Plate Negatives, 1890/1925

2.08 Linear Feet 2 ft. 1 in. (5 document cases, 5 in. each)
Abstract Or Scope

Includes 88 glass plate negatives documenting subjects from Grafton and Taylor County, West Virginia from circa 1890-1925. Subjects include farming scenes, classrooms and schools, stores, bridges, tunnels, railroads, bands, rivers, home and town scenes, saw mills, industry, and churches and cemeteries. Four boxes contain the original glass plate negatives while one box contains the original sleeves for the negatives, including identifying information where present. Digitized copies of the glass plate negatives are available.

Victorian Photo Album Photographs, 1890/2019

0.4 Linear Feet Summary: 9 in. x 12 in. x 4.5 in. 0.74 Gigabytes 8 .mts files
Abstract Or Scope
Victorian photo album (with exterior of faded dark burgundy cloth and tarnished gold-toned bas-relief ornaments) with built-in music box containing cartes-de-visites, cabinet cards, postcards, tintypes, and two negatives. Includes individual and family group portraits. Subjects of photographs are unidentified, except for postcard portrait of Pastor J.O. Patterson of Main Street Church of Christ in Elkins, West Virginia. Photographers are identified on some of the card mounts, including Loar and Company of Grafton; Von Allmen of Elkins; Nestor of Elkins; Arcade Studio of Akron, Ohio; Fad Foto Company of Gallipolis, Ohio; and Stanton Photo Company of Springfield, Ohio. The collection also includes the calling card of Jackson J. Triplett and two gift tags illustrated with roses and doves. Digital material includes recordings of the music box.
